Responsibilities

  • Perform schematic capture support and PCB layout for complex, high-reliability electronics (multilayer, high-speed, mixed-signal, and power designs)
  • Execute constraint-driven layout including impedance control, differential routing (e.g., Ethernet), and power integrity considerations
  • Collaborate with electrical, mechanical, and thermal engineers to ensure design integration
  • Generate and review fabrication and assembly drawings, stackups, and design notes
  • Support DFM/DFA reviews with fabrication and assembly vendors
  • Iterate designs based on prototype feedback, test results, and manufacturing input
  • Own and maintain the Altium component library as the single source of truth for all PCB designs
  • Create and manage symbols, footprints, and 3D models with strict adherence to internal standards
  • Ensure all components are linked to approved part numbers in PLM (e.g., Teamcenter)
  • Define and enforce library standards (naming conventions, parameter sets, lifecycle states, revision control)
  • Perform library QA to ensure accuracy, manufacturability, and compliance with standards (IPC, NASA, internal)
  • Support engineers in proper part selection and usage of library components
  • Support release processes from Altium Designer to PLM systems
  • Ensure all design data packages are complete, consistent, and manufacturable at release
  • Maintain traceability between schematic, layout, BOM, and PLM records
  • Participate in ECO/NCR processes and implement design updates accordingly
  • Contribute to fabrication/assembly notes, marking standards, and coating/staking documentation
  • Drive consistency across projects by enforcing repeatable design practices
